CSS er værktøjskassen til skæg og ballade og når du ønsker at opnå en bestemt effekt ved at ændre den måde tingene ser ud på. F.eks ved at ændre skrifttypen og størrelsen på teksten. Det er op til forfatterne at afgøre om der er sammenhæng mellem effekt og budskab. Alle brugere har også lov til at blande sig i valg af CSS.
Cases
Da det tager lidt tid at forklare alt omkring CSS har vi valgt nogle typiske Spademanns cases ud, som du kan studere
Inden du går i gang
Tilgængelighed
Hvad betyder CSS
CSS er en forkortelse for Cascading Style Sheets. Det er et sprog som skal sørge for skabe konformitet på en webside.
Her på sitet benyttes den hen ad vejen til at formattere forskellige elementer.
Der findes en hovedregel indenfor webdesign, som hedder at al det man laver skal kunne opfattes ens på samtlige platforme dvs. browsere.
Til daglig brug er det ikke noget man behøver at tænke dybere over, da MediaWiki sørger for den tilgængelighed, hvis bare man holder sig til deres tags.
Hvis man derimod bruger CSS er der style-properties som den ene browser ikke vil anerkende eller som hedder noget andet hos den anden.
Her kan du se hvilke style properties som alle browsere vil acceptere:
Brug af styles
På Spademanns kan man kun omforme ting vha HTML-style-propertien dvs. ved brug sammen med en anden HTML/wikitekst-tag. Hvis du vil bruge din egne stylesheets kan du oprette det i dit eget navnerum Bruger:HansHannibal/monobook.css.
Eksempler på brug af style
|
Tag
|
Eksempel
|
Beskrivelse
|
Div
|
<div style="color:red;border:black solid 1px;">
Det der skal styles</div>
Det der skal styles
|
Div laver en box om din tekst/billeder. Den er som udgangspunkt 100% bred. Er perfekt til skabeloner og faktabokse.
|
Span
|
<span style="color:red;border:black solid 1px;">
Det der skal styles</span>
Det der skal styles
|
Span følger automatisk indholdet. Er specielt god til tekst
|
Table
|
{|
!Tabel
|-
|style="color:red;border:black solid 1px;"|
Det der skal styles
|}
Tabel
|
Det der skal styles
|
|
Man kan også bruge style i wikitext-tabeller. Man kan som i en HTML-table vælge at lade style-taggen gælde for cellen, rækken eller hele tabellen alt efter hvor man anbringer den.
|
Derudover kan du med bruge style i andre HTML-tags som sædvanligt.
Eksempler på steder hvor du ikke kan anvende styles
Da MediaWiki primært er skabt til tekst og billeder og ikke fis og ballade, findes der HTML-tags, som du ikke kan formattere uden at bruge et stylessheet.
- Links
- Anchor-taggen i Mediawiki har begræsninger: Disse pseudoklasser kan ikke bruges:a:link,a:active a:visited a:hover.
Hvis du alligevel vil ændre farven på dit link foregår det vha. <span>:[[Begmand|<span style="color:magenta;text-decoration:none;">Begmand</span>]]
giver:Begmand
Derudover kan man ikke specificere target til eksterne links.
- Baggrundsbillede
- Du kan ikke bruge baggrundsbillede: background-image
Bidragsydere:
Cookies help us deliver our services. By using our services, you agree to our use of cookies.